Villa Restaurant Group (formerly Villa Enterprises Management) is a privately owned restaurant franchisor. Its five brands have over 330 franchised and corporate locations in 38 US states and six countries. The company was founded in 1964 by Michele Scotto as a pizzeria called Villa Pizza, located next to the original Ed Sullivan Theater on Broadway in New York City. Villa Enterprises has five fast-casual restaurant brands: Villa Italian Kitchen, Green Leaf's, Bananas Smoothies & Frozen Yogurt, South Philly Steaks and Fries, and The Office Beer Bar & Grill.[1]
